UNC may only be given a 5 seed, but it can earn so much more
Posted Mar 14, 2014
Most likely, the Tar Heels will be a No. 5 seed. The Tar Heels, though, have no ceiling when it comes to how far they can advance into the NCAA Tournament. Let’s put it this way: The Tar Heels have a much better chance of being one of the final eight teams standing than they do of being one of the top eight seeds.
